Introduction of Wastewater Solution



Wastewater systems are important facilities elements that play an essential duty in taking care of previously owned water from property, commercial, and farming sources. These systems are developed to gather, discharge, transportation, and treat wastewater, ensuring that it is processed successfully prior to coming back the setting. The main elements of a wastewater system include collection networks, treatment facilities, and discharge systems.


Collection networks usually contain a series of pipelines and pumping stations that gather wastewater from various sources and direct it to therapy facilities. Therapy facilities are equipped with advanced innovations that get rid of virus and pollutants, transforming polluted water right into a cleaner state appropriate for launch or reuse. This process typically entails numerous stages, consisting of initial, primary, second, and often tertiary treatment, each made to deal with particular impurities.


The final phase of a wastewater system includes the safe discharge or recycling of cured water, which can be returned to all-natural water bodies or repurposed for irrigation and industrial procedures. By effectively taking care of wastewater, these systems not only shield public health and the environment yet likewise add to the lasting use of water resources, making them essential in modern-day infrastructure.




Ecological Influences of Poor Management



The consequences of inadequate wastewater management can be profound, resulting in substantial ecological destruction. Inadequately taken care of wastewater systems often lead to the contamination of regional water bodies, presenting damaging contaminants such as heavy metals, microorganisms, and nutrients. This contamination can interrupt aquatic environments, resulting in decreased biodiversity and the decline of sensitive species.


Furthermore, unattended or improperly treated wastewater can add to eutrophication, a process where excess nutrients stimulate algal blossoms. These flowers deplete oxygen degrees in the water, producing dead areas that are unwelcoming to most marine life. In addition, the existence of microorganisms in untreated wastewater presents severe public health threats, potentially leading to waterborne illness that affect both human and animal populaces.


Soil contamination is an additional vital worry, as leachate from improperly taken care of wastewater can infiltrate groundwater products, jeopardizing alcohol consumption water top quality. The advancing effects of these ecological influences prolong beyond prompt eco-friendly repercussions, adding to lasting challenges such as environment adjustment and source scarcity. Consequently, understanding and attending to the implications of poor wastewater monitoring is vital for advertising ecological sustainability and making certain the health of areas and ecosystems alike.

Cutting-edge Technologies in Wastewater Treatment



Improvements in ingenious modern technologies are changing wastewater treatment procedures, lining up with the goals of sustainability and performance. These technologies encompass a variety of approaches designed to enhance the therapy procedure while decreasing environmental impact. One significant improvement is the application of membrane bioreactors (MBRs), which integrate organic therapy with membrane layer purification, resulting in high-grade effluent and reduced energy consumption.

An additional significant technology is making use of innovative oxidation processes (AOPs), which efficiently weaken natural contaminants and virus, guaranteeing much safer discharge right into water bodies. In addition, the integration of expert system and artificial intelligence into monitoring systems enables for real-time information evaluation, enabling operators to enhance therapy processes and react without delay to system anomalies.


Additionally, the introduction of decentralized therapy image source systems supplies flexible options for areas, lowering the need for extensive infrastructure and promoting resource recovery through nutrient recycling. These innovations not only improve treatment effectiveness however likewise contribute to a round economic climate by recovering useful sources from wastewater. As the sector continues to evolve, embracing these cutting-edge innovations will play a crucial function in achieving environmental sustainability and making sure a reliable wastewater monitoring system for future generations.
